Gothenburg-metal, but not from Gothenburg

Sunnuntaina 15. heinäkuuta 2007

Soilwork has long been included in the infamous Gothenburg metal scene, but as the band itself likes to remind people, the actually hail from Helsingborg.Lue koko artikkeli »

The rap and horn styles of Us3

Sunnuntaina 15. heinäkuuta 2007

This year Ilosaari Rock put Us3 in the line-up, a base that first won acclaim in the United States through Blue Note Records in the 90s, but that has also been invited to perform around the world. After seeing their gig, it’s not hard to understand why: the group’s jazz samples and live horns coupled with the lead rappers’ self confidence in their skills brought their music to life in the true spirit of performance for an attentive crowd at the III stage.Lue koko artikkeli »

Porcupine Tree in Finland. Finally!

Sunnuntaina 15. heinäkuuta 2007

23porcupinetree_mp02.jpgOne of the most anticipated bands in whole Ilosaarirock has most definetely been Porcupine Tree. The band started its recording career in the beginning of the 90s, and has since achieved solid cult reputation. Their latest album, Fear of a Blank Planet, is frequented by prog rock legends Robert Fripp and Alex Lifeson.
